Mirror of Literature,  11 (1828), 181.

French Charade

T S A

Genre:

Letter, Introduction; Extract, Poetry

Publications extracted:

Ladies Diary

Subjects:

Mathematics


    Introduces a French riddle, and its translation: 'My first in Euclid holds distinguish'd place; / My second rolls incessantly through space: / My whole, 'tis said, is rich, and rules the sea; But wine they drink there, is too dear for me'; suggests that the answer is 'Angleterre'.
